Foundation Crack Sealing in Tampa, FL

Foundation crack sealing involves applying specialized materials to fill and seal cracks in a building’s foundation. This service is commonly requested for projects where visible cracks have appeared in basement or slab foundations, which can occur due to settling, temperature changes, or shifting soil. Property owners typically seek crack sealing to prevent water infiltration, reduce the risk of further structural damage, and improve the overall stability of the foundation. Before requesting this service, homeowners often want to understand the size and location of the cracks, as well as whether the cracks are active or stable, to ensure the appropriate sealing method is used.

Sealing foundation cracks is suitable for various types of projects, including small surface cracks and larger, more extensive fissures. It is important for property owners to know that the effectiveness of crack sealing depends on proper diagnosis of the crack’s cause and condition. Homeowners should also consider whether the cracks are accompanied by other signs of foundation movement, such as uneven floors or sticking doors, which may require additional assessment or repair. Proper crack sealing can help maintain the integrity of the foundation and protect the property from potential water damage and structural issues.

FAQ

Foundation Crack Sealing Questions

What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es around the property.

Are foundation cracks a sign of structural issues? Not all cracks indicate serious problems; some are cosmetic, but it's important to assess their size and pattern.

How does sealing foundation cracks help? Sealing prevents water infiltration, which can lead to further damage and helps maintain the stability of the foundation.

What types of cracks are typically sealed? Commonly sealed cracks include hairline fractures and wider gaps that compromise water resistance and structural integrity.
